Blue Ridge Parkway Evening Hike planned for Sept. 5

From the National Park Service:

BLUE RIDGE PARKWAY EVENING HIKE
Bringing Mountains-to-Sea

Join Parkway rangers on Thursday, September 5th at 7:00pm for an easy evening stroll starting from the third oldest river in the world. Learn about the geology and history, as well as the effects it has had on the area, chewing mountains to dust and taking them to the sea. Explore an interesting area that is so close to town!

Meet just north of the French Broad River Bridge (north of NC-191/Brevard Road intersection) on the Parkway. There is a gravel lot alongside the Mountains-to-Sea trail for parking. Bring water and good walking shoes. We also suggest wearing long pants and bug spray because of poison-ivy and mosquitoes. Be prepared for varying weather conditions, including evening rain.
